Funfetti Cheesecake Cups

We love no bake treats around here, and these are absolutely delicious! They are so easy to make and your family will absolutely love them. Storing These can be stored in the refrigerator for up to five days. If planning on storing, leave off the toppings, and use the mason jar lids to seal them. I do not recommend freezing these as the texture of the cream cheese will change in an unfavorable way....

Italian Sausage Ragu Di Salsiccia

Why is this easy ragu (meat sauce) so easy? Because it’s made using Italian sausage which is already seasoned. Salsiccia is Italian for sausage. For this recipe, I use a combination of sweet and spicy sausage that adds just the right amount of spicy kick to the sauce without being overpowering. Ragu (a meat heavy tomato sauce) is classically Italian. This sauce takes a lot less time than my low and slow cooked Traditional Bolognese Sauce (which is worth the wait, by the way)....
